Overview
The Amazon Fire TV Stick 4K is a compact streaming dongle that turns any HDMI-equipped TV into a smart 4K streaming device. It’s designed for cord-cutters, apartment dwellers, and anyone who wants crisp HDR picture quality, faster app navigation, and access to free and live TV without renting a new TV. The newest model adds AI-powered Fire TV Search to surface shows across apps faster and Wi‑Fi 6 support to reduce buffering on congested home networks. With Dolby Vision, HDR10+/HDR10/HLG support and Dolby Atmos pass-through, it’s a strong upgrade for viewers who want better color, contrast, and immersive sound from a tiny, affordable plug-in stick.
Key Features
- Resolution and HDR: Streams up to 4K UHD at up to 60 fps with Dolby Vision, HDR10+, HDR10 and HLG support
- Connectivity: Wi‑Fi 6 (802.11ax) for faster, more reliable wireless streaming on compatible routers; Bluetooth for accessories
- Processor & Storage: Quad-core processor with around 2 GB RAM and roughly 8 GB internal storage for apps
- Audio & Controls: Dolby Atmos pass-through support and Alexa Voice Remote with power, volume, and mute buttons for connected TVs
- Content & Search: AI-powered Fire TV Search that surfaces content across apps and services; access to Amazon Prime Video, Netflix, Disney+, and free/live TV channels
Pros & Cons
Pros
- AI-powered Fire TV Search speeds up finding shows across apps and subscriptions
- Wi‑Fi 6 (802.11ax) support reduces buffering and improves performance on modern routers
- 4K UHD with Dolby Vision, HDR10+, HDR10 and Dolby Atmos pass-through for improved picture and sound
- Compact plug-and-play design with Alexa Voice Remote for voice search and TV controls
- Access to a massive catalog — over 1.8 million movies and shows plus free and live TV channels
Cons
- Limited onboard storage (about 8 GB) restricts how many apps you can install
- No built-in Ethernet — wired connection requires a separate adapter
- Performance gains depend on having a Wi‑Fi 6 router and a fast internet plan
- Remote uses replaceable batteries and lacks a rechargeable option
